Q: Is 143,150,034 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 143,150,034 is a composite number.

Why is 143,150,034 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 143,150,034 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 2,039 4,078 6,117 11,701 12,234 23,402 35,103 70,206 23,858,339 47,716,678 71,575,017 and 143,150,034, with no remainder.

Since 143,150,034 cannot be divided by just 1 and 143,150,034, it is a composite number.
